Hello! Let’s take some time to explore one of organelles vital to the function of a cell…the nucleus. The nucleus is found in all eukaryotic cells. The nucleus was actually the first organelle ever discovered with drawings dating back to the early 1700’s, but it wasn’t until the 1900’s that the nucleus was discovered to be the main organelle responsible for hereditary information. We are able to look through this microscope and observe the nucleus in many cells, but let’s go even further “inside” the cell for an even closer look. Look at all of these structures. These other organelles, such as the mitochondria and endoplasmic reticulum, also play a vital role in how a cell functions, but let’s work our way over to this round organelle. This is the nucleus. It is surrounded by its own membrane, the nuclear envelope. It is actually two membranes, an inner and outer one. Its purpose is to protect the genetic information inside the nucleus from the rest of the cell. The outer membrane is also studded with another organelle, the ribosome. Inside of the nucleus is the cell’s genetic information or DNA. The DNA is organized into structures called chromosomes which would become visible when the cell undergoes mitosis or cell division. The darker circle is the nucleolus, and this is the site for making new ribosomes for the cell. Inside the nucleus, the chromosomes serve as the site for transcription, which is where DNA codes for the production of RNA to start the process of protein synthesis. This process is essential to a cell for gene expression. The nucleus is sometimes called the “boss” of the cell as it helps dictate what occurs in the rest of the cell.

To answer this question, we need to understand the process of protein synthesis. Protein synthesis is the process by which cells build proteins using the instructions encoded in DNA. It involves two main steps: transcription and translation.

Transcription occurs in the nucleus. During transcription, the DNA sequence in a gene is used as a template to synthesize a complementary RNA molecule called messenger RNA (mRNA). This mRNA molecule carries the genetic information from the nucleus to the cytoplasm, where translation takes place.

DNA, short for deoxyribonucleic acid, is a large macromolecule that carries the hereditary information of organisms. It contains the instructions that code for the synthesis of proteins and other cellular components. In eukaryotic cells, DNA is mainly found in the nucleus, although small amounts can also be found in mitochondria and chloroplasts.

The nucleus is surrounded by a double membrane known as the nuclear envelope. The nuclear envelope consists of an inner membrane and an outer membrane, with a small space called the perinuclear space in between. These two membranes protect the genetic information inside the nucleus from the rest of the cell.
